Michigan Capitol Confidential Internship
The Mackinac Center’s news website, Michigan Capitol Confidential, seeks an intern to work on research that contributes to news stories and investigations. The ideal candidate must have a willingness to dig for and document information. Past interns have also had the opportunity to publish articles, contribute to the blog and attend events. Candidates are to submit a resume, a cover letter and a 700-word essay on any policy issue by March 27, 2026. Email: Interns@mackinac.org.
